CNIoT 2025 Conference Review
The 2025 5rd International Conference on Green Communication, Networks, and the Internet of Things (CNIoT 2025) was successfully held. CNIoT 2025 covers communication, network, Internet of Things, IT energy sensing technology, artificial intelligence applications and other fields. The conference provides an international multidisciplinary cross-integration platform for excellent experts, scholars and industry talents who focus on this research field to exchange new ideas and display research results. The conference also discussed the development trend of the academic industry and promoted the industrialization of academic achievements.
Keynote Speeches

The first keynote speaker is Prof. Yonghui Li, from The University of Sydney, Australia
The speech title:
Beyond 5G for Industrial IoT

The second keynote speaker is Prof. Tao Gu, IEEE Fellow, AAIA Fellow, ACM Distinguished Member
from Macquarie University, Australia
The speech title:
Intelligent Sensing: Challenges and Opportunities
.

The third keynote speaker is Prof. Lingfeng Shi,
from Xidian University, China
The speech title:
Indoor Positioning Technology Based on Smartphones

The final keynote speaker is Prof. Maode MA
from Qatar University, Qatar
The speech title:
Batch Message Authentication with Edge Server Supports in IIoT
